KNEC Admits to Posting Un-truncated 2023 KCPE Results

Spread the love

The Kenya National Examination Council on Saturday evening admitted to posting misleading results through the bulk SMS service.

The examining body, however maintained that the results on the official portal were accurate and properly truncated. 

Truncated simply means if it was a B(plus) it would have the appropriate signage B+.

Satirical social commentator and journalist Gabriel Oguda used the following analogy for the KNEC blunder.

“The Kenya National Exams Council has hurriedly released a statement covering their tracks for the incompetence they have shown the country since the KCPE 2023 results were released.

SOME IMPORTANT POINTS TO NOTE.

FIRST – The KCPE 2023 results were released on Thursday and not Wednesday as claimed here. If the people who released the results don’t even know when they did it, how are we supposed to trust the source of the results themselves?

SECOND – The Exams body admits that the SMS Service Provider picked results from a source not related to the KNEC portal. This is a grave revelation that has the potential for a class action suit for parents who spent money on fake results.

THIRD – KNEC admits they awarded wrong results for students who complained, and they’ve since correctly updated the scores.

TRANSLATION: If you feel your child received results they didn’t deserve, please hurry while stocks last.

FOURTH – An entire KCPE class of 50 scoring 75% each in the Science Paper is not cheating according to KNEC. The new term for cheating is COINCIDENCE. You learn a new thing every day.

FIFTH, and most importantly. You wasted your time and money sending SMS to the short code number, when you could just have walked to your school and received the real results that KNEC recognizes.

Thanks for throwing easy money on fake results.

It was nice doing business with you, and see you again when the KCSE 2023 results are announced shortly.”
